Send us Fan MailWhat happens when the person you're grieving is still here? In this deeply empathetic episode, "How to Grieve Someone Who Is Still Alive," we explore the complex and often baffling world of ambiguous grief. This unique type of loss occurs when a loved one is physically present but psychologically absent (such as with dementia, addiction, or a severe brain injury) or when they are physically absent but emotionally present (like a missing person or an estranged family member).In This Episode, You'll Learn:What ambiguous grief is and why it feels so different from traditional grief.The unique challenges and emotional turmoil of grieving someone who is still alive—including the lack of closure, social misunderstanding, and constant emotional limbo.A practical, 4-step process to help you understand and cope with ambiguous grief, providing a framework to acknowledge your loss and move forward without 'moving on.'If you've ever felt guilty, confused, or isolated while mourning a relationship that hasn't fully ended, this episode is a vital guide to naming your pain and finding a path toward healing.
